What is an Operations Lead Job Description?

An Operations Lead Job Description is a document that outlines the responsibilities, expectations, and qualifications for a role that oversees various operational aspects within an organization. Typically, this includes details on managing teams, streamlining processes, and delivering on business objectives. A well-crafted job description can help attract suitable candidates by clearly articulating the role’s requirements and aligning them with the organization’s goals.

Creating new PDFs from scratch vs uploading existing files

Users can either create a new PDF from scratch or upload an existing file to modify. Starting from zero provides complete control over formatting and content, enabling the creation of a tailored job description. Conversely, uploading an existing file can save time if a similar job description is available and only needs minimal adjustments. The decision depends on the specific requirements of the job listing.

Construction Operations Manager Roles A construction operations manager, on the other hand, is more concerned with the execution of each specific step of the construction process. These are the experts overseeing the day-to-day operations of construction projects, ensuring everything runs like a well-oiled machine.
Operations is a crucial aspect of the construction and building industry, which encompasses all the activities involved in planning, managing, executing, and controlling the processes required to deliver a project successfully.
Construction work is far more complex than just stacking bricks or operating heavy machinery and no one understands this better than construction operations managers. In essence, their main task is overseeing various aspects of operations simultaneously to ensure projects are completed on time and within budget.
What does an operations manager do in construction? At a high level, construction operations managers solve problems that might impede their employer's ability to produce deliverables on time and within budget. This often means addressing urgent problems that arise day-to-day.
